Summary: newly bootstrapping nodes hang indefinitely in status STATUS:BOOT while JOINING cluster
Key: CASSANDRA-5129
UR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/CASSANDRA-5129
Project: Cassandra
Issue Type: Bug
Components: Core
Affects Versions: 1.2.0
Environment: Ubuntu 12.04
Reporter: Michael Kjellman
bootstrapping a new node causes it to hang indefinitely in STATUS:BOOT
Nodes streaming to the new node report
{code}
Mode: NORMAL
Nothing streaming to /10.8.30.16
Not receiving any streams.
Pool Name Active Pending Completed
Commands n/a 0 1843990
Responses n/a 2 661750
{code}
the node being streamed to stuck in the JOINING state reports:
{code}
Mode: JOINING
Not sending any streams.
Nothing streaming from /10.8.30.103
Nothing streaming from /10.8.30.102
Pool Name Active Pending Completed
Commands n/a 0 10
Responses n/a 0 613577
{code}
it appears that the nodes in the "nothing streaming" state never sends a "finished streaming" to the joining node.
no exceptions are thrown during the streaming on either node while the node is in this state.
